__________________________________________________________ The U.S. Department of Energy Computer Incident Advisory Capability ___ __ __ _ ___ / | /_\ / \___ __|__ / \ \___ __________________________________________________________ INFORMATION BULLETIN Sun Solaris newtask(1) Command Vulnerability [Sun(sm) Alert Notification 52111] April 1, 2003 21:00 GMT Number N-069 ______________________________________________________________________________ PROBLEM: A vulnerability exists in the newtask(1) command that may lead to unauthorized root access. PLATFORM: Solaris 9 DAMAGE: If exploited, a local unprivileged user may be able to gain unauthorized root access. SOLUTION: Apply patch or workaround. ______________________________________________________________________________ VULNERABILITY The risk is MEDIUM. Impact A local unprivileged user may be able to gain unauthorized root access due to a security issue with the newtask(1) command in Solaris 9. 2. Contributing Factors This issue can occur in the following releases: SPARC Platform Solaris 9 without patch 114713-01 x86 Platform Solaris 9 without patch 114714-01 Notes: Solaris 2.6 and 7 do not have the newtask(1) command and are therefore not affected by this issue. Solaris 8 is not affected by this issue. 3. Symptoms There are no predictable symptoms that would show the described problem has been exploited to gain root privileges. Solution Summary Top 4. Relief/Workaround To work around the described issue, remove the setuid bit from newtask(1): # chmod u-s /usr/bin/sparcv7/newtask # chmod u-s /usr/bin/sparcv9/newtask # chmod u-s /usr/sbin/i86/whodo Note: removing the set-user-ID bit from the "newtask" binary will prevent unprivileged users from using the "newtask" command. 5. Resolution This issue is addressed in the following releases: SPARC Platform Solaris 9 with patch 114713-01 or later x86 Platform Solaris 9 with patch 114714-01 or later This Sun Alert notification is being provided to you on an "AS IS" basis.
